Mini How-To for the FB Pilot Bearing

Here's a detailed description of my $58 pilot bearing removal experience (or $72 if you don't get one the 20% off coupons that rain down on your mail slot every week). The Autozone had the 2 jaw slide hammer one, but it was pretty beat up, someone had already ground it for their job and it looked iffy. So I went to HF with my replacement pilot bearing to see how well it fit on their attachment.

1. Get the HF 62601 bearing puller, https://www.harborfreight.com/slide-...-pc-62601.html
I suppose this shot gives it away, but that's my old pilot bearing on the end of it, just after removal. The tool looks decently built, though a bit rough. The screw that expands the jaws goes deep and lends strength to the assembly. Some of the Amazon/eBay examples had too much cantilever for the jaws and folks had posted shots of various failures.
https://cimg5.ibsrv.net/gimg/www.rx7...55a6eac787.jpg

2. I looked at the end of the expanders and they seemed a bit too tapered, especially compared to the Mazda tool (as shown on the Pineapple Racing site). I figured if they had a shoulder instead of a taper, the jaws could sit more appropriately and would grab the outer race of the PB, rather than sliding past it or just grabbing the inner race and leaving the shell. So I got out the hand file...
https://cimg1.ibsrv.net/gimg/www.rx7...ea94d3183c.jpg

And worked the taper down like this (red line) as much as I felt I could get away with

https://cimg0.ibsrv.net/gimg/www.rx7...bd60f17d76.jpg

And to make sure I wouldn't interfere with the inside surface of the eccentric shaft, I broke the sharp edge back, indicated by the green line above. So once the tool expands you get a little bit better shoulder for the outer race but the jaws don't extend past the external circumference of the old PB as you draw it out.

https://cimg3.ibsrv.net/gimg/www.rx7...3797adccd3.jpg

You can argue that it would have worked with out this mod, but I'll never know, fortunately. 3 or 4 *solid* whacks later and it was out.

Pilot Bearing General Stuff
 
Observation: the PB is not an extremely tight fit where the rollers engage the tranny's input shaft. I don't have a lot of experience but both the old and the new one feel about the same, i.e. there's a small bit of play.

There had been questions about the orientation of the PB seal. The rubber seal side goes against the PB facing into the bore rather than being visible looking at it after installation. It's how the factory installed PB seal was oriented on removal.

GSLSEforme 08-09-18 04:24 PM

I thought you got front cover gasket when you got trans seals? Suggestion(what i would do)... if the trans was not noisy and the retrieved measured shim is .006-0.15 source the same thickness shim and use oe Mazda front cover gasket which will be same exact thickness as what's on front cover now which will preserve original specification and put it back together.

0.15 shim is Mazda part # 9996-36-315 still a good # and available still from Mazda Dealer. Get busy

For others' reference:
9996-36-315 is for the .15mm/.006in part.
9996-36-330 is for the .3mm/.012in part.

- Changed the tranny seals. Rear is super easy to remove and likewise to just gently tap back in. Get a thin edged tool under the seal's return (brown looking circle in the photo), you could even use a thick box cutter blade to get in, and then progress to a drywall tool, like this
https://cimg1.ibsrv.net/gimg/www.rx7...76ed46116a.jpg
Work your way around and as you get a bigger gap, keep the dryall tool flat against the tail housing to protect the aluminum cast, and wedge a slot blade screwdriver in, and work your way around.

The front one was just annoying to remove...there's no way to push it from behind the seal and pulling just shreds it. To remove mine I used a dremel cutoff wheel and *very* carefully cut through the metal ring embedded in the seal.
Shot 1 shows the seal's embedded metal ring with the rubber cut away (this is after removing the seal). That outside edge is about 1/16th and that's your margin of error before you grind into the seal seat.
Shot 2 is after the fact with the newly installed seal but shows the general idea. Tear all of the the rubber away from the inner part, then just go slowly, cutting through the metal. Grab at it with needle nose pliers and pull it inward "peeling" it away and upward from the seat. Swear a lot, cut some more, and it will come out.
Shot 3 shows the old seal after the fight. I guess I won...no damage to the seat. I wonder how the pros do this, because it just took too long my way.

https://cimg7.ibsrv.net/gimg/www.rx7...d38432cf78.jpg


I pressed the new seal in with a 32mm socket and a rubber hammer. Get it started straight in, then whack it in the rest of the way with the socket.

GSLSEforme 08-10-18 03:21 PM

I'll post a pic of tool i use to remove input shaft seal,takes about as long as it took you to get pilot bearing out with right tool.

I use "A" drop of blue loctite on t/o bearing support plate bolts.

Original pressure plate attaching bolts will have lock washers and original driveshaft attaching hardware is same. "A" drop of blue loctite would do no harm.

Installing/seating flywheel(put some grease around surface where main seal lip rides for some lubrication on startup)should be done by hand. Don't knock woodruff key out of position installing flywheel,you can see it from clutch side when installed.
Your plan to use breaker bar to tighten flywheel nut will be successful.....at turning the engine. How did you initially loosen gland nut? Easiest way to tighten is with impact gun. Mark nut and flywheel and tighten,let gun impact 3-4 x then check distance marks have moved. Repeat 2nd time.Marks probably in same place=tight enough. I do use red loctite on gland nut for flywheel.

If a loctited fastener proves stubborn at loosening,heat fastener with a propane torch for a about a minute. Heat liquifies the loctite allowing removal.

Centered the clutch, cross torqued the cover down at 20 lb/ft, making note of where the 2x shoulder bolts go as opposed to the 4x full thread. Here's some detail on those bolts and the tapped holes on the flywheel...you want the shoulder bolts to go into the shouldered holes, shown in the lower detail photo, the 2 are located across from one another diagonally.

GSLSEforme 08-12-18 06:30 PM

When you put trans in place as input shaft goes into seal/pilot bearing,seal will squeegee the grease to the rear of that part of input shaft. Wipe that down to just a very slight amount with your finger. Put SOME(more is not better) grease on your little finger and apply it to rollers in pilot bearing and wipe a litttle around lip of seal.. A very slight amount of heavy grease on splines of input shaft and wipe top surface of splines. Use an acid brush to paint it into the splines evenly,just a film,any more will get slung off.

Regarding cat heat shield,you could just leave it off or have someone attempt welding it back together and put it back on. OR...you could take car to competent muffler shop,remove all the cats and pipe section back to muffler and have a new downpipe made up from exhaust manifold and a single modern cat put in and save your original setup. Car will be noticeably peppier and will have a barely perceptible change in exhaust note.

Why am i recommending this? When these cars were new and still under warranty(low miles) Mazda had a campaign to replace the pellets in main cat. I did hundreds of these,take cat off,flip it over,take recessed plug out of top and shake/tap and vacuum out pellets and put a can of new ones in,recap,reinstall with new gaskets. A fair amount of these cats had pellets melted together,some golfball size,some larger that needed to be broken up to get pellets out. Some cats had to be replaced. You can imagine what this did to drivability/power/fuel mileage.
Many of the cars ran stronger on test drive afterwards.

GSLSEforme 08-14-18 10:23 PM

What brand,quality part did you put on the car when you replaced the clutch m/cyl& slave cyl. Get the Wagner one,and replace that hose if it's original,could be contamination from inner layer breaking down.

When's the last time you flushed clutch hydraulics and brakes with fresh fluid,should have been done at least a couple times since those parts were installed. A lot of people are unaware this needs to be done.Looks like broken down brake fluid. Brake fluid is hygroscopic which means it pulls moisture out of the air.
.
Moisture combining with brake fluid lowers boiling point of brake fluid does nasty things to seals,pistons and bores like what you see in your pic. Long term causes binding,dragging,leaking caliper and wheel cylinders.

On a daily driver,a flush and bleed should be done about every 30k miles. On a car that sits more than driven at least every other year.
It is possible to drive a vehicle several hundred thousand miles and never have to replace a m/cyl,caliper,wheel cyl. by regularly flushing/bleeding hydraulics. This is even more true with motorcycles,yet you never see anybody pushing this kind of service. Manufacturers don't,they want you to replace vehicle with new.
For what brake fluid costs and time it takes to flush/bleed it's a should do along with other fluids being changed.
If you have replaced the clutch hydraulic hose,take it off and put some brakleen thru it and blow out with compressed air before attaching it to cyls.

Summary of Parts Bought, Original ListExtra parts along the way
  • Replacement tranny front bearing clearance shim, from Mazda Dealer. If not ripped up, just keep and reuse. If destroyed, then measure the thickness with decent calipers and replace with same. Part numbers are 9996-36-315 is for the .15mm/.006in part, 9996-36-330 is for the .3mm/.012in part.
  • New clutch master and slave cylinders. Slave was blown out, parts are cheap. I used DOT4. I've read that DOT4 and 5 are compatible but the guy at the store says no, DOT4 was good enough back in the day, so I'm cool with it, all new fluid anyway.
  • FYI: Racingbeat sells both seals and the front cover gasket in a kit, Transmission Seal Kit for 79-88 Non-Turbo - Racing Beat for $21 +SH
  • More annoying than it should have been: Exhaust gaskets for front pipe to cats, and from mid pipe to muffler pipe that jumps over the rear axle. Nothing I could find online listed the actual dimensions. Went to Autozone with a tracing and this part fits: Bosal #256-535.
  • Replacement muffler bolts for midpipe to muffler (front pipe studs/nuts were super clean!). Ended up using grade 9.8 M10x35mm 1.50 pitch thread. Original was M10x40mm 1.25.
Tools (beyond the "normal" stuff I had)
  • Had to get a thinner walled (non impact style) 14mm socket to reach the bell-housing to engine bolt that is inset behind the starter, ~$5 at Ace
  • Slide hammer/blind bearing puller, HF Item 62602, $73 list so get a 20% off coupon.
  • You should buy a seal pull tool for the front transmission seal, it will save you an hour of frustration, the bonus is you will not damage the seal seat with a grinder (i was careful and didn't but it would be easy to wreck the seat).
That Damn Mid Boot :P
  • Reinstalling the shifter was not as awful as I thought it would be, just had to be persistent. The mid boot was glued in, so no dice moving it without possibly ripping it up, and I was completely against the idea of trimming it, even slightly. So to prepare, I poured in "enough" gear oil into the shifter linkage (it pooled up a bit), greased the ball end of the shifter and a bit of grease where it goes in the tranny. With the mid boot still covering the 3x 10mm bolts would go, it looks like this (photo before cleanup etc.)
    https://cimg5.ibsrv.net/gimg/www.rx7...83668d6674.jpg
    • grease up the top bushing enough to stick it in place on the top of the ball, aligning the keyway in the ball with the bushing's detent (as described earlier in the thread).
    • pop the ball end into the linkage with the bushing riding along, aligned as above, inserting the ball's keyway onto the guide pin and shoot for he right hand side of the spring.
    • of course, now you can't see the alignment, so you have to go by feel.
    • gently move the shifter into 1st gear position and slide the back edge of the cover into the boot, it is difficult as the hole is small.
    • work the lip of the boot up and over the sides.
    • move the shifter to 4th, work the rest of the boot up and over the cover.
    • now, gently but firmly hold the cover down and move the shifter to feel for proper, smooth operation. If the cover won't sit flush or there is binding don't force it. You'll have to start over.
    • rotate the cover to align the holes, bolt it on with enough pressure to hold it, not getting medieval on it, just secure. Check for smooth operation.
I got lucky and it went in aligned and worked smoothly.
